Most creators pay $200 a month for AI tools they could run for free on hardware they already own. This episode breaks down what Docker actually does in plain English, what a consumer graphics card buys you for AI workloads, which open-source models replace which paid subscriptions, and the honest break-even math on when the do-it-yourself route makes sense.
